Small Bumps On The Head Of Penis. No Pain And Itching Sensation. Cure?

Hello Doctor,

I have noticed some small bumps on the head of my penis. They are similar in colour to the colour of my skin, but a bit lighter. There are a few of them, about 3 close together to the right, and 3-4 from the middle to the left, each a few millimeters at the most. They are not painful, or itchy, and there is nothing coming out of them. I have not engaged in any sexual activity for over 10 months (since October 2012 I believe), and the last time I did, it was just unprotected oral sex, although the woman I was with is an escort.

Would you be able to tell me what this is? I can provide pictures if possible/necessary.
